DTC P0101: Mass Airflow Meter Circuit Range/Performance: Notes

WARNING: This page is about a different car, the 2003 Toyota RAV4. However, it is still accessible from the selected car via links, so may be relevant.
NOTE: If DTCs P0100, P0101, P0110, P0115 and P0120 are output simultaneously, the E2 sensor ground circuit at terminal No. 18 (Brown wire) at ECM electrical connector E5 may be open. See ENGINE PERFORMANCE in SYSTEM WIRING DIAGRAMS article in ELECTRICAL. For ECM electrical connector terminal identification, see Figure. It may be necessary to check Brown wire between splice I2 and terminal No. 18 at ECM electrical connector E5. Splice I2 is located behind passenger's side of instrument panel. See Figure.
